WebIn general, fair can refer to to justice, complexion, or a carnival. It can also be used to describe something that is good. Fare refers to food, money, or how something is going. It’s fair to say that some people don’t fare well with the fair amount of differences between "fare" and "fair." That sentence was hard to write. WebRemember fair is a noun, adjective, and adverb, whereas fare is a noun and verb. If an adjective (or adverb) is called for, fair is the word; if a verb is wanted, fare is the choice. … WebFree from favoritism or self-interest or bias or deception; conforming with established standards or rules
